About Anaïs Tobalagba, Phd

A passionate Human Rights Lawyer, Business & Human Rights (BHR) practitioner and Researcher, I have 10+ years of experience working on sustainability, human rights and environmental due diligence (HREDD), natural resources governance, energy transition, and gender in BHR. I work with governments, non-governmental organisations, multilateral institutions and businesses to develop and enhance HREDD practices. I conduct advanced field research to assess the impacts of business activities in host countries, integrating strategies to evaluate and respond to gender-specific risks.I am multilingual in French, English, Spanish and Portuguese.
